**Ticket #4471 — DateShape sandbox env misconfigured**

Hey plugin folks — if your locale previews in the DateShape sandbox are rendering everything as ISO-8601, that's on us. The sandbox shipped without the formatting service credentials, so it silently falls back to defaults. Fix: open your sandbox `.env` and make sure it ends with the line granting formatter access, shown below.

secret setting of tahop-yagaf: COURIER_KEY8=3821f1bd

Subject: Key rotation — font vendoring pipeline

Team,

Ahead of the weekly sync, a heads-up that we have rotated the credential used by the Glyphbarrow pipeline, which vendors third-party fonts into our internal artifact store. The old key triggered a stale-scope warning during last week's audit, so we reissued it with read-only fetch scope and a 90-day expiry. Build agents pick up the change automatically at their next run; local scripts must be updated by hand. The new key follows.

API key for yahig-tadup: kto7_ubizbYm

Subject: Key rotation — Faregrid pricing experiment

Plugin authors: the key used by the Faregrid ticket-pricing experiment rotates Friday. Old keys stop working at 09:00 UTC. The experiment endpoints (`/quotes`, `/variants`) are unchanged; only the credential changes. Update your plugin config before the deadline or quote calls will return 401. No action needed for read-only metrics plugins. Test against staging first if you can. The new key for the internal pricing service is below.

API key for tagef-fafop: vxb2-ta

## Runbook: Read-Replica Lag Alarm (Quillbase)

When the `replica_lag_high` alarm fires, the Quillbase replica in the Dunmore cluster is more than 90 seconds behind primary. First verify whether a bulk import from the Cartfold pipeline is running; if so, the lag is expected and self-resolves. Otherwise, query the internal Lagwatch diagnostics service for replication stats. Lagwatch requires an authenticated call, and its service key appears directly below.

app token of kajop-tahag = qvz23-qaEp6MzrfP2AwhVbZwsZeUq